Good morning, Providence. Here's your local news at a glance for Sunday, the 15th of December.

COMMUNITY NEWS

  • Rhode Islanders are encouraged to vote on the state's best shopping destinations for holiday gifts, with results to be revealed on December 20.  The Providence Journal

ACCIDENTS NEWS

  • Firefighters quickly contained a fire in a three-story Providence home on Vernon Street, with the cause under investigation.  10 WJAR

EDUCATION NEWS

  • Providence School Board President Erlin Rogel and Vice President Travis Escobar will not seek reappointment, opening leadership positions as the city discusses regaining control of public schools by 2025.  10 WJAR
  • Providence Mayor Brett Smiley hosts a community conversation to assess progress and challenges in Providence Public Schools five years after state intervention.  ABC 6

HEALTH NEWS

  • The Rhode Island Department of Health reprimanded two doctors, one for self-issuing a medical marijuana certification and another for having surgery privileges reduced due to care standard assessments.  Go Local Prov

LIFESTYLE NEWS

  • The compilation of 2024's most popular 'Car Doctor' Q&As from The Providence Journal provides readers with expert advice on various auto issues, from maintenance tips to finding reliable mechanics.  The Providence Journal
  • Yawgoo Valley Ski Area in Rhode Island opens for the 2024-2025 winter season, offering skiing on weekends with more trails expected to open soon.  ABC 6

SPORTS NEWS

  • Providence basketball lost to St. Bonaventure 74-70 despite a late comeback attempt, missing key player Bryce Hopkins due to a left knee irritation.  The Providence Journal
